What companies run services between Chepstow, Wales and Romford, England?

You can take a train from Chepstow to Romford via Newport (S Wales) and London Paddington in around 3h 6m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Chepstow Bus Station Stand 2 to Romford Station via London Victoria Coach Station Arrivals, Victoria Station, Trafalgar Square, and Charing Cross in around 5h 45m.
